Hi, I gave today's sparc.git a try on a SS20 with SuperSparc-II and another one with HyperSparc CPUs. Starting with an UP kernel, I got some bugs on the SuperSparc and a segfault on the HyperSparc, see below for bootlogs. I can test patches etc. If more info is required, please let me know.
